CNV_20000135 - Details

  • The SAP error message CNV_20000135: Action cancel performed by user typically occurs during data migration or conversion processes, particularly when using the SAP S/4HANA Migration Cockpit or other data migration tools. This message indicates that the user has canceled an ongoing action or process.
    
    Cause: User Intervention: The most straightforward cause is that the user manually canceled the operation. This could be due to a change in requirements, a realization that the data being processed is incorrect, or simply a decision to halt the process for any reason. System Timeout: Sometimes, if a process takes too long, users may decide to cancel it, thinking it has stalled. Errors in Data: If the data being processed has issues (e.g., validation errors), users might cancel the operation to address these issues before retrying. User Interface Issues: Occasionally, the user interface may not respond as expected, leading users to believe they need to cancel the action.
